Emulator OS is running as Hyper-V VM, Windows 10X – is nested VM. Saduff commented on 2020-01-08 21:17. Ghidra … IDA (and now Ghidra) feel like an IDE, while radare2 feels more like Vim. Improve this question. The overall response for Ghidra's release … This is an integration of the Ghidra decompiler for radare2. It’s worth learning these commands though. While all these tools are great, and although Radare2 was showed there (and oh boy, things went wrong), there was one tool, which is dear to my heart, that wasn’t there – Cutter. yifanlu on Mar 6, 2019. No book yet. Even though ghidra … 2.5. Thanks for all the comments. Decompilers: IDA Hex-Rays vs Ghidra. Binary Ninja Alternatives. Ghidra attempts to use standard OS directories that are designed for these … If the executable is in the PE format and has been compiled with debug support Ghidra will start to populate the function names correctly. I found radare2 very helpful with many CTFs tasks and my solutions had shortened significantly. Radare2 is basically a open source framework designed to help disassemble software. Ghidra uses Java reflection in a manner that has been deprecated in newer versions of Java. The decompiler of ghidra is great, but is better to learn to read assembly, so I recommend to you to start with radare. Windows. Radare is a portable reversing framework that can… Disassemble (and assemble for) many different architectures; Debug with local native and remote debuggers (gdb, rap, webui, r2pipe, winedbg, windbg) Radare2 is an open source reverse engineering framework that supports a large number of different processors and platforms. 0 0 vote. The site may not work properly if you don't, If you do not update your browser, we suggest you visit, Press J to jump to the feed. If you just need to disassemble a few lines of x86 to complete some basic CTF challenge, use radare2. Try both out, I use both for different reasons (I like ghidras decompiler but love r2 for pretty much everything else). Conference. What happens when a discovery leaves IDA upon your own computer and meets the real world? 366. If that doesn't suit you, our users have ranked 12 alternatives to radare2 so hopefully you can find a suitable replacement. Completely FREE and licensed under GPLv3. I am not saying that Ghidra is bad as a matter of fact I think Ghidra will be my choice for any future RE projects.I have seen similar failures with IDA and Radare 2 so it's not a Ghidra specific … New comments cannot be posted and votes cannot be cast. By demonstrating some of the features that Radare2, Ghidra, and Binary Ninja offer for the task, the viewer can get some sense of the things they can get from using these tools. Ghidra failed here, because it is using Java or Python2 (Jython to be honest). A proof-of-concept of disassembling using this engine is already available as the pdgsd command. This was the only point I could find information on online and it seems like ghidra was working more efficient with decompiling but I have no idea if this is true or not. Ghidra's fine for quick simple static analysis though. Pro SQL Server Internals is a book for developers and database administrators, and it covers multiple SQL Server versions starting with SQL Server 2005 and going all the way up to the recently released SQL Server 2016. Radare2 can be used in many ways, from commandline or shellscripts by calling the individual tools: $ rasm2 -a arm -b 32 -d `rasm2 -a arm -b 32 nop` $ rabin2 -Ss /bin/ls # list symbols and sections $ rahash2 -a md5 /bin/ls $ rafind2 -x deadbeef bin . Radare2. Native integration of Ghidra's decompiler in Cutter releases. No Java involved. I gave numerous workshops and talks about it at various security conferences, served as a GSoC … IMO radare … Latest commit . Radare2; Windbg; Ghidra; What’s your favorite ollydbg alternate? New comments cannot be posted and votes cannot be cast, More posts from the securityCTF community, Looks like you're using new Reddit on an old browser. Patching Binaries (with vim, Binary Ninja, Ghidra and radare2) – bin 0x2F. It is COMPLETELY FREE of cost and open source Software Reversing Engineering(SRE) tool developed by the NSA. Article Rating. I mean having a good UI is great but without the features to back it up, you can’t do anything serious. Using PDB files with Ghidra. This tool has a thriving community. RedZ is a new contributor to this site. A lot has changed since I wrote this tutorial, both with radare2 and with me. Your feedback was amazing and I am very happy for the opportunity to teach new people about radare2. Is there a good source (most preferably book) that explain Ghidra in detail? In March 2019, the National Security Agency of the US Department of Defense (NSA) has published Ghidra, a free reverse engineering toolkit. Other interesting radare2 alternatives are IDA (Paid), OllyDbg (Free), Ghidra … Disassembly vs Decompilation; Teach students how to use the Ghidra SRE tool to reverse engineer Linux based binaries. Ghidra's decompiler is also really good. Signatures⌗ Radare2 is open source and has a lot of features. Native integration of Ghidra's decompiler in … If you're committing to a career in RE then might as well start now, but if you want something solid and more user friendly to use right away then go Ghidra. It offers lots of situation commands that I’ve never needed to use. The binaries were released at RSA Conference in March 2019; the sources were published one month later on GitHub. Graph View. Open Source. Intermediate Language: Binary Ninja vs Ghidra. 11 1 1 bronze badge. Binary Ninja is described as 'A reverse engineering platform and GUI' and is an app in the Development category. Versions for radare2-ghidra-dec. 1 package(s) known. Disassembled function displayed as graph. Share. To access the help, press F1 or Help on any menu item or dialog. In order to extract strings from native code used in an Android application, you can use GUI tools such as Ghidra or Cutter or rely on CLI-based tools such as the strings Unix utility (strings ) or radare2… Ghidra's decompilation is extremely good, it's also useful if you are newer to reverse engineering because you can simply click on lines in the decompilation window and it will take you to the relevant assembly in the main window - which is good for learning what various C constructs look like in assembly. Shouldn't you then name this package radare2-cutter-ghidra-git? Repository Package name Version Category Maintainer(s) Parrot main: radare2-ghidra-dec: 4.2.1: devel: dmknght@parrotsec.org: Absent in repositories. Join the Community Ghidra is one of many open source software (OSS) projects developed within the National Security Agency. Ghidra vs. IDA Pro. I am new to reverse engineering binaries and I can't decide what software to use. Tweet. ... GHIDRA; Ghidra … Felipe Pires janeiro 18, 2021 28 Comentários. Follow asked 3 hours ago. Leave a comment below. Cutter releases are fully integrated with native Ghidra decompiler. This guide is mainly for me to build a list of useful commands and tips. Share. Ghidra; Radare2/Cutter; Cuckoo Sandbox; Get the Free Pen Testing Active Directory Environments EBook “This really opened my eyes to AD security in a way defensive work never did.” Malware Analysis Tools and Techniques. Ghidra (pronounced Gee-druh; / ˈ ɡ iː d r ə /) is a free and open source reverse engineering tool developed by the National Security Agency (NSA). I kind of like that minutes minimalist CLI-only approach o radare (I am a vim enthusiast) but I am not sure if it is worth the probably steep learning curve for all the shortcuts since I am probably going to use the software for about an hour a week on average just for hobby purposes like ctfs. Related Posts: x64dbg vs Ollydbg vs IDA Pro; 6 Best 64 bit debuggers for Windows, Linux and Mac - 2019 ; 10 Best IDA PRO Alternatives for reve Intermediate Language: Binary Ninja vs Ghidra. It is even possible to run Radare2 … 12 alternatives; Popular filters ; None; 29. x64dbg. Ghidra: IDA: Radare2 (Cutter): ida radare2 ghidra. I am now, for several years, a core member in the radare2 team and a maintainer of Cutter, a modern, GUI-based, reverse engineering framework that is powered by radare2. Artikel: NSA-Tool Ghidra: Mächtiges Tool, seltsamer Fehler; Themen: Reverse Engineering, Backdoor, Malware, NSA, Nist, Applikationen; Foren › Kommentare › Applikationen › Alle Kommentare zum Artikel › NSA-Tool Ghidra: Mächtiges Tool… Radare2 ‹ Thema › Neues Thema Ansicht wechseln. Support for an architecture can be added via Sleigh; IDA has been refactored to include an undo feature in version 7.3 ; Share. r2con Videos That’s why I created a Radare2 cheatsheet. Radare2; Radare is a portable reverse engineering framework which contains many different tools to assist in the process. Future versions of Ghidra will address this in order to ensure compatibility with the newest versions of Java. Sadly, I believe that only few people are familiar with radare2. You’ll also find over time that certain tools do certain things better sometimes. I also don't know if ghidra maybe has an even longer time needed for getting used to it since it seems like a more professional tool. If nothing happens, download the GitHub extension for Visual Studio and try again. You can NEVER have too many tools in your tool belt. I mean having a good UI is great but without the features to back it up, you can’t do anything serious. So the options we open-sourced community have is Ghidra and radare2. radare2IDA ProGhidra IDA Pro has triumphed the reverse engineering universe as GUI capabilities and user-friendly interface it offers. Except deleting this package and creating a new one. I really like radare2 API, because it is just radare syntax :P Then binja API seems to be very intuitive, IDA contains the most complex API. Windows 10X emulator is Hyper-V based. Disassembly. I kind of like that minutes minimalist CLI-only approach o radare (I am a vim enthusiast) but I am not sure if it is worth the probably steep learning curve for all the shortcuts since I am probably going to use the software for about an hour a week on average just for hobby purposes like ctfs. Ida Pro Vs Ghidra. It should build fine, again, once you have updated/rebuilt your radare2-git package. yifanlu on Mar 6, 2019. Next just Go to the menu option File -> Load PDB File. Libre and Portable Reverse Engineering Framework. Also (and possibly most importantly) how do the algorithms, features and workflow of the two tools compare? Open Source. Using PDB files with Ghidra. Otherwise learn to love Ghidra :P. As others have said, in an ideal world you would learn to use both competently, there is always a tool better suited to a particular task! It is solely based on the decompiler part of Ghidra, which is written entirely in C++, so Ghidra … To access the help, press F1 or Help on any menu item or dialog. Press question mark to learn the rest of the keyboard shortcuts, https://www.youtube.com/playlist?list=PLq9n8iqQJFDopqDiGHPPrDutLtzyqDGuR. Basic navigation and usage; How to identify and reconstruct structures, local variables and other program components; Demonstrate and explain the methodologies used when approaching an unknown program with Ghidra I am new to reverse engineering binaries and I can't decide what software to use. If you're committing to a career in RE then might as well start now, but if you want something solid and more user friendly to use right away then go Ghidra. Here are slides from the presentation that compare Ghidra, IDA and Binary Ninja: 3-way comparison. I started to use radare2 in the beginning on 2012, and my first contribution to it was in August 2013. Reverse Engineering With Radare2. This describes quite well the impact and open-source benefits of the Ghidra. The list of alternatives was last updated Dec 6, 2019. radare2 info, screenshots & reviews Alternatives to radare2. Cutter releases are fully integrated with native Ghidra decompiler. Written by Nik Zerof. If the executable is in the PE format and has been compiled with debug support Ghidra … Debugging Windows 10X emulator . Issue Tracker. A similar project that has been successful is the existing integration of Ghidra's decompiler into radare2, r2ghidra-dec. I kind of like that minutes minimalist CLI-only approach o radare (I am a vim enthusiast) but I am not sure if it is worth the probably steep learning curve for all the shortcuts since I am probably going to use the software for about an hour a week on average just for hobby purposes like ctfs. No Java involved. Search this site. Just no. Why: Radare2 is similar to IDA Pro, but the big difference is that Radare2 is open source while IDA Pro is proprietary. Then you can attach IDA PRO, Ghidra or radare2 to GDB stub. Técnicas Patching Binaries (with vim, Binary Ninja, Ghidra and radare2) – bin 0x2F. Pin. Ghidra's decompiler is also really good. Radare2 is similar to tools like IDA pro, Binary Ninja and Ghidra, but the main difference is that radare runs inside of a terminal window. From someone who does binary reverse engineering full time, in my experience, BinaryNinja, Hopper, radare2… Radare has more features but is more difficult to learn and get started with. I tried cutter again a few months ago and went back to ida after an hour of frustration. There are three giants in the reverse engineering world. IDA (and now Ghidra) feel like an IDE, while radare2 feels more like Vim. Know someone who can answer? x64dbg is a 64-bit assembler-level debugger for Windows. Radare2 also offers lots of useful commands that I struggle to remember and are hidden away in the documentation. Go back. I was playing a lot with radare2 in the past year, ever since I began participating in CTFs and got deeper into RE and exploitation challenges. Otherwise learn to love Ghidra :P. As others have said, in an ideal world you would learn … This is nice because it means that radare can be used over a ssh connection or on low power machines. It can be useful at times. Radare2 is similar to tools like IDA pro, Binary Ninja and Ghidra… if I can use Visual Studio 2003. Cookies help us deliver our Services. Debugger (beta) Multiplatform native and remote debugger for dynamic analysis. Radare vs Ghidra I am new to reverse engineering binaries and I can't decide what software to use. Also (and possibly most importantly) how do the algorithms, features and workflow of the two tools compare? Radare2 Background: Released 2006, it is similar to IDA Pro in that it supports a lot of platforms. IMO radare is better but it's a pretty steep learning curve. Continue this thread View Entire Discussion (21 Comments) More posts from the ReverseEngineering community. It is expected to see Java warnings the about illegal reflective access, especially when importing new files. Launching Visual Studio. A couple of important points: Ghidra … This was the only point I could find information on online and it seems like ghidra was working more efficient with decompiling but I have no idea if this is true or not. I'm not a professional reverse engineer, so this is my only advice :). BinaryNinja and radare2 have plugin managers which helps you to install plugins & keep them updated. Decompiler. It’s sometimes also my go-to tool for malware analysis tasks such as configuration retrievals. Ghidra is probably one of the best alternatives to IDA Pro. Ghidra is seen by many security researchers as a competitor to IDA Pro. By using our Services or clicking I agree, you agree to our use of cookies. See GDB debugging example in part 3 of article (debugging hypervisor). A quick demonstration on 33c3 conference. Press question mark to learn the rest of the keyboard shortcuts. Radare2. Radare2 is an open source reverse engineering framework that supports a large number of different processors and platforms. Visit our Wiki. No book yet. maximevince commented on 2020-01-09 08:58. Take care in asking for clarification, commenting, and answering. A couple of years ago, I had read about it on WikiLeaks and was eager to lay hands on the software used by the NSA for reverse engineering. Ghidra provides context-sensitive help on menu items, dialogs, buttons and tool windows. If you just need to disassemble a few lines of x86 to complete some basic CTF challenge, use radare2. JuniorJPDJ commented on 2020-04-08 14:26 SVG badges with packaging information for project radare2-ghidra-dec This task should thus be implemented in r2ghidra's codebase. Learn ethical hacking. Is there a good source (most preferably book) that explain Ghidra in detail? Thank you for reading till the end & have a beautiful day! Radare2 is built around the same principle as IDA Pro, delivering great support and documentation as well supporting tons of different platforms, from Linux ELIF to ARM.
Pga Scorecard Holder,
What's A Good Response To Whatever,
Lane Frost Brand,
Lg Smart Thinq Multiple Users,
Centuries Memorial Obituaries,
Ghost Corn Snake For Sale,
Seranaholic From The Skyrim Nexus,
Mgs2 Pc Pressure Sensitive,
Sean Donahue New Hyde Park,